Racial/Ethnic Minority Children’s Use of Psychiatric Emergency Care in California’s Public Mental Health System

African American children used both kinds of crisis services more than did White children, and Asian Americans/Pacific Islander and American Indians/Alaska Native children visited only when they experienced the most disruptive and troubling kind of crises, and made nonrecurring visits.
